Ukrainian Media Landscape: Challenges and Developments

The Ukrainian media landscape is currently navigating a complex environment marked by both challenges and opportunities. As the country continues to grapple with ongoing geopolitical tensions, media outlets are adapting their strategies to maintain relevance and credibility.

In recent years, the rise of digital platforms has transformed how news is consumed and disseminated in Ukraine. Traditional media outlets are increasingly competing with online news sources, which often provide real-time updates and diverse perspectives. This shift has prompted established media organizations to innovate in order to retain their audience.

Moreover, the ongoing conflict in Eastern Ukraine has heightened the importance of accurate reporting. Journalists face significant risks while covering the situation, and the need for reliable information has never been more critical. In this context, media integrity is paramount, as misinformation can exacerbate tensions and lead to further conflict.

In response to these challenges, various initiatives have emerged aimed at supporting journalistic integrity and promoting media literacy among the public. Organizations focused on training journalists and enhancing reporting standards are becoming increasingly vital in fostering a well-informed citizenry.

Despite these efforts, the media sector in Ukraine still grapples with issues related to censorship and political influence. The government and various political entities have been known to exert pressure on media outlets, complicating the landscape for independent journalism. This ongoing struggle underscores the necessity for robust protections for press freedom.

As the situation evolves, the resilience of Ukrainian media will be tested. The ability of journalists to adapt to new technologies and navigate the challenges posed by both external and internal pressures will be crucial in shaping the future of news reporting in Ukraine.
